U*BET FA Trophy first and second round draws

Sixty-six teams will be taking part in the seventy-fifth edition of the U*BET FA Trophy. This includes the twelve clubs from the Premier League, the twelve clubs from the First Division, the fourteen clubs in the Second Division, the fifteen clubs in the Third Division and thirteen clubs from Gozo.

The draws for the first and second rounds were held on Friday at the Centenary Hall, Ta’ Qali by MFA CEO Bjorn Vassallo and Maltco Lotteries General Director Vasileos Kasiotakis.

The only team not taking part are Gozitan side Zebbug Rovers while Ta’ Xbiex SC and Gozitans Qala Saints and Munxar Falcons are taking part for the first tie.

MFA CEO Bjorn Vassallo said that thanks to the new format of the competition all local clubs are now benefitting financially whie improving their image. He said the association, together with clubs are doing their utmost so that ‘product football’ continues to evolve.

Vassallo said that last season no club lost money in participating in domestic competitions. Hopefully they will do even better this season as the national leagues will be played in seven stadiums, following the recent addition of the Sirens Stadium.

The MFA CEO said that last season’s U*BET FA Trophy final was a feast of football and hopefully this year’s edition will be the same. He said smaller clubs are being given the opportunity to face stronger clubs and on some occasions the determination and enthusiasm of the smaller clubs lead them to give their opponents a hard time. This new format of the competition also led to more solidarity between the smaller and the bigger clubs, therefore uniting more the football family.

He concluded by thanking Maltco Lotteries for their support over the past years and praised them for entering a new agreement at a time when the new ten-year concession to operate lotteries in Malta and Gozo had not been awarded yet.

Maltco Lotteries General Director Vasileos Kasiotakis said this was the eighth year of sponsorship of the FA Trophy by the company and the first after being awarded ten-year concession and a licence to operate the National Lottery of Malta.

Kastiotakis stressed Maltco Lotteries’ intention to keep supporting the committee and said that with the sponsorship, the level of the game could be improved.

Third Division and Gozitan clubs were included in the First Round draw. At least four Gozitan clubs will be reaching the Second Round due to four all-Gozitan first round clashes: Kercem vs Ghajnsielem, Nadur vs Gharb, Xaghra vs Oratory and Qala vs Xewkija.

The winners of the first round matches join First Division and Second Division clubs in the Second Round.

Ticket prices for all U*BET FA Trophy matches will be €6 for adults, €4 for holders of Kartanzjan and €1 for children.

The dates for the other rounds are as follows:
Third Round – winners of second round plus Premier League clubs – 30 November to 2 December 2012
Fourth Round – 18 to 23 January 2013
Quarter-Finals – 17 February 2013
Semi-Finals – 10 and 11 May 2013
Final – 19 May 2013
